Pet Groomers in Iola, Wisconsin

Showing 2 Pet Groomers

Dee-O-Gee Care

(715) 575-1005

E1256 Johnson Rd

Iola, Wisconsin

Reba's Personal Touch Pet Salon

(715) 467-0003

E1256 Johnson Rd

Iola, Wisconsin